About This Trip
Experience the magic of Iceland like never before on this Iceland Summer Vacation (June–September). This 9-day private and bespoke tour is crafted to showcase the country’s most stunning natural wonders, from geothermal springs and glacial lagoons to dramatic waterfalls and black sand beaches. Relax in the iconic Blue Lagoon, explore the rugged landscapes of Snæfellsnes Peninsula, and marvel at the incredible waterfalls of Godafoss, Barnafoss, and Hraunfossar.
Witness the wildlife of Iceland on an unforgettable whale-watching tour in Húsavík, cruise past floating icebergs at Jökulsárlón Glacier Lagoon, and stroll along the striking Diamond Beach. Top off your adventure by discovering the famous Golden Circle, including Thingvellir National Park, Geysir Geothermal Area, and Gullfoss Waterfall. Perfect for nature lovers, photographers, and adventure seekers, this summer escape promises an unforgettable journey across Iceland’s most iconic landscapes.

- Day 1: Arrival & Relax at Blue Lagoon – Reykjavik
Begin your Iceland Summer Vacation by arriving at Keflavik Airport, where your private driver will greet you. Enjoy a short transfer to the iconic Blue Lagoon, a geothermal spa surrounded by lava fields. Soak in the mineral-rich waters, known for their healing properties, and relax after your flight. Later, transfer to your Reykjavik hotel, stroll around the city, or enjoy Icelandic seafood for dinner.
Highlights: Blue Lagoon, Reykjavik hotel stay, volcanic landscapes, geothermal spa

- Day 2: Reykjavik City Sightseeing & Drive to Snæfellsnes Peninsula
Kick off your Iceland Summer Vacation with a guided city tour of Reykjavik. Visit the landmark Hallgrímskirkja Church, the glass Harpa Concert Hall, and the historic Hofdi House, famous for the Reykjavik Summit. After lunch, drive 2.5–3 hours to Snæfellsnes Peninsula, admiring dramatic coastal cliffs and lava formations. Watch the midnight sun and relax at your hotel.
Highlights: Hallgrímskirkja, Harpa Concert Hall, Hofdi House, Snæfellsnes Peninsula, midnight sun

- Day 3: Full-Day Exploration of Snæfellsnes Peninsula
Explore the “Miniature Iceland” on your Iceland Summer Vacation. Visit Búðakirkja Church, stroll coastal paths in Arnarstapi village, admire the stone arch Gatklettur, and marvel at Lóndrangar basalt cliffs, steeped in folklore. Capture perfect photos of Kirkjufell Mountain and its double waterfalls. Enjoy local cuisine and unwind at your hotel.
Highlights: Búðakirkja, Arnarstapi, Gatklettur, Lóndrangar, Kirkjufell, birdwatching, Icelandic folklore

- Day 4: Drive to Lake Mývatn Area – Waterfalls & Scenic Stops
Continue your Iceland Summer Vacation with a scenic drive north to Reykjahlidh. Stop at Hraunfossar, where water flows from lava rock, and Barnafoss, with its legendary story. Visit Godafoss, a horseshoe-shaped waterfall. Optional scenic stops include fishing villages and fjord viewpoints. Overnight stay at Lake Mývatn area.
Highlights: Hraunfossar, Barnafoss, Godafoss, northern fjords, local Icelandic cuisine

- Day 5: Lake Mývatn & Whale-Watching in Húsavík
Explore Lake Mývatn on your Iceland Summer Vacation, famous for volcanic landscapes and birdlife. Visit Skútustaðagígar pseudo-craters, Dimmuborgir lava fields, and Námaskarð Pass. In the afternoon, head to Húsavík for a whale-watching tour, spotting humpback, minke, and blue whales, as well as puffins and seabirds. Return to your hotel in Reykjahlidh for a relaxing evening.
Highlights: Lake Mývatn, Dimmuborgir, Námaskarð, whale-watching in Húsavík, Arctic marine life

- Day 6: Scenic Drive to Hnappavellir – East Fjords & Villages
Drive along Iceland’s majestic east coast during your Iceland Summer Vacation. Stop at Djúpivogur, a charming fishing village with colorful houses and art installations. Capture the scenic fjords, wild horses, and rolling hills. Check in at your hotel in Hnappavellir and enjoy dinner with local ingredients. Evening walks are perfect under the midnight sun.
Highlights: East Fjords, Djúpivogur village, coastal photography, Icelandic horses, local cuisine

- Day 7: Jökulsárlón Glacier Lagoon & Diamond Beach – Drive to Vík
Visit the world-famous Jökulsárlón Glacier Lagoon on your Iceland Summer Vacation. Cruise among floating icebergs, observe seals, and explore Diamond Beach, where sparkling ice contrasts with black sand. Drive 3 hours to Vík, and end the day at Reynisfjara Black Sand Beach, with its basalt columns and Reynisdrangar sea stacks.
Highlights: Jökulsárlón Glacier Lagoon, Diamond Beach, Reynisfjara Beach, Reynisdrangar, seal spotting

- Day 8: Golden Circle Exploration & Return to Reykjavik
Drive back to Reykjavik while exploring the Golden Circle on your Iceland Summer Vacation. Visit Skógafoss and Seljalandsfoss waterfalls, the erupting Geysir Geothermal Area, Gullfoss Waterfall, and Thingvellir National Park,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Enjoy your final night in Reykjavik with a farewell dinner of Icelandic delicacies.
Highlights: Skógafoss, Seljalandsfoss, Geysir, Gullfoss, Thingvellir, Golden Circle, Icelandic cuisine
